Which materials are most common, and what benefits do they provide?
The main materials are high-quality plastic, food-grade silicone included in some sets, and borosilicate glass for a more “premium” option. Plastic is lightweight and cost-effective, silicone is flexible and suitable for repeated use in collapsible containers, and borosilicate glass provides thermal resistance and better chemical inertness. Each material brings specific advantages for storage, transport, and cleaning.

How can you keep food fresh and prevent leaks?
Choose containers with airtight lids or a silicone seal that creates a barrier against moisture and odors. For glass options, sets with hydraulically sealing lids stay airtight and are compatible with the refrigerator and freezer, making it easier to store different foods without leaks.
What cleaning and care options are available for these containers?
Most of these containers are easy to wash by hand, and some sets are dishwasher-safe. To keep seals clear and in good condition, remove the lids and let everything dry completely before storing. Material choice also matters: glass containers hold up well to washing, while plastic and silicone need gentle handling to maintain transparency and integrity.
